在不爆炸的前提下减少AI与自定义序列同开的限制 (#136)

This commit is contained in:
huaji2369
2021-07-22 00:11:25 +08:00
committed by GitHub
parent 908997ddef
commit 35c38387e1
7 changed files with 13 additions and 9 deletions

View File

@@ -54,7 +54,7 @@ return{
page="Page:", page="Page:",
ai_fixed="The AI is incompatible with fixed sequences.", ai_fixed="The AI is incompatible with fixed sequences.",
ai_prebag="The AI is incompatible with custom sequences.", ai_prebag="The AI is incompatible with custom sequences which have nontetramino.",
ai_mission="The AI is incompatible with custom missions.", ai_mission="The AI is incompatible with custom missions.",
saveDone="Data Saved", saveDone="Data Saved",
saveError="Failed to save:", saveError="Failed to save:",

View File

@@ -44,7 +44,7 @@ return{
page="Página:", page="Página:",
ai_fixed="La IA no es compatible con secuencias de piezas prefijadas.", ai_fixed="La IA no es compatible con secuencias de piezas prefijadas.",
ai_prebag="La IA no es compatible con secuencias de piezas personalizadas.", --ai_prebag="The AI is incompatible with custom sequences which have nontetramino.",a IA no es compatible con secuencias de piezas personalizadas.",
ai_mission="La IA no es compatible con misiones personalizadas.", ai_mission="La IA no es compatible con misiones personalizadas.",
saveDone="Datos guardados", saveDone="Datos guardados",
saveError="Error al guardar:", saveError="Error al guardar:",

View File

@@ -45,7 +45,7 @@ return{
page="Page:", page="Page:",
ai_fixed="L'IA est incompatible avec les séquences fixes.", ai_fixed="L'IA est incompatible avec les séquences fixes.",
ai_prebag="L'IA est incompatible avec les séquences personnalisées.", --ai_prebag="The AI is incompatible with custom sequences which have nontetramino.",'IA est incompatible avec les séquences personnalisées.",
ai_mission="L'IA est incompatible avec les missions personnalisées.", ai_mission="L'IA est incompatible avec les missions personnalisées.",
saveDone="Données sauvegardées", saveDone="Données sauvegardées",
saveError="Sauvegarde échouée : ", saveError="Sauvegarde échouée : ",

View File

@@ -45,7 +45,7 @@ return{
page="Página:", page="Página:",
ai_fixed="A inteligência é incompatível com sequências fixas.", ai_fixed="A inteligência é incompatível com sequências fixas.",
ai_prebag="A inteligência é incompatível com sequências fixas.", --ai_prebag="The AI is incompatible with custom sequences which have nontetramino.", inteligência é incompatível com sequências fixas.",
ai_mission="A inteligência é incompatível com missões costumizadas.", ai_mission="A inteligência é incompatível com missões costumizadas.",
saveDone="Data Salva", saveDone="Data Salva",
saveError="Falha ao salvar:", saveError="Falha ao salvar:",

View File

@@ -54,7 +54,7 @@ return{
page="页面:", page="页面:",
ai_fixed="不能同时开启AI和固定序列", ai_fixed="不能同时开启AI和固定序列",
ai_prebag="不能同时开启AI和自定义序列", ai_prebag="不能同时开启AI和含有非四连块的自定义序列",
ai_mission="不能同时开启AI和自定义任务", ai_mission="不能同时开启AI和自定义任务",
saveDone="保存成功!", saveDone="保存成功!",
saveError="保存失败:", saveError="保存失败:",

View File

@@ -22,7 +22,7 @@ return{
finesse_fc="全连击", finesse_fc="全连击",
ai_fixed="不能同时开启电脑玩家和固定序列", ai_fixed="不能同时开启电脑玩家和固定序列",
ai_prebag="不能同时开启电脑玩家和自定义序列", ai_prebag="不能同时开启电脑玩家和含有非四连块的自定义序列",
ai_mission="不能同时开启电脑玩家和自定义任务", ai_mission="不能同时开启电脑玩家和自定义任务",
ranks={"","","","",""}, ranks={"","","","",""},

View File

@@ -55,8 +55,12 @@ function scene.keyDown(key,isRep)
MES.new('error',text.ai_fixed) MES.new('error',text.ai_fixed)
return return
elseif #BAG>0 then elseif #BAG>0 then
for _=1,#BAG do
if BAG[_]>7 then
MES.new('error',text.ai_prebag) MES.new('error',text.ai_prebag)
return return
end
end
elseif #MISSION>0 then elseif #MISSION>0 then
MES.new('error',text.ai_mission) MES.new('error',text.ai_mission)
return return